siding in the borough of Brooklyn, city and The invention is applicable to machines of various types.
It comprises a laterally. adjustable readily removable gage-plate adapted to be applied to the paper table of a typewriting machine.
In the accompanying drawings: Figure 1 is a plan view showing the paper table of a Royal Standard typewriting machine (well known in the market) having applied to it two paper gages: Fig. 2, a' plan view of a paper gage detached from the paper.
table: and Figs. 3, 4 and 5 are views-illustrating the mode of attachment of the gage to the paper table- 1 indicates the paper table. The gage comprises a fiat sheet-metal body portion 2 formed with an integral spring clip 3 at its upper or rear end and with a jaw 4 at its front or forward end constituting a spring or friction latch for engaging. the front or lower edge of the paper table.
Fig'. '3 indicates the manner in which the gage is initially applied to the paper table, the spring clip portion3 being forced down over the upperedge of the table into the position shown in Fig. 4:, and then the forward edge of the gage is pressed down until the portion 4 snaps over or around the front edge of the paper table as indicated in Fig. 5. This affords a sufliciently secure connec tion of the gage to the table and yet permits .of the gage being moved laterally-on the table. Atbne edge of the body portion 4,
preferably the outermost edge, there is a turned up lip or flange extending from the forward edge of the gage tothe rear edge.
This flangeis marked 5, 5, the part 5 being preferably of greater Width than the ortion 5. .The, purpose of this difference 1n width is to provide a part 6 that is bent outwardly and constitutes a convenient handle or finger piece by which the gage may be grasped and manipulated.
In Fig. l, the paper table is shown as h av'-' ing secured to it two gages the inner faces of the flanges 5, 5' of, which. engage the edges of a card or sheet of paper fed to the p machine. Devices of this character are particularly useful 1n writing on cards or on forms ruled in vertical columns. The gages when once properly adpisted serveto pro sent the cards or ruled sheets unii'onmlv to the platen with respect to the printing-point thereon.
